The problem addressed in this study is the limited number of anatomical and histological studies of the reticulated python?s digestive tract that can be utilized as visualbased interactive media. The methods used were qualitative descriptive analysis to examine the anatomical and histological structure of the reticulated python?s digestive tract and research and development (R&D) to produce the interactive e-booklet. Observations were conducted on the esophagus, stomach, small intestine, and large intestine through the stages of fixation, dehydration, embedding, sectioning, and Hematoxylin-Eosin staining, followed by microscopic examination. The research results indicate that the digestive tract of the reticulated python possesses distinctive anatomical and histological structures, where each organ consists of four main layers: the serosa, muscularis, submucosa, and mucosa. The interactive e-booklet was developed using the Canva application with the addition of various features such as images, videos, audio, links, and quizzes, and was subsequently converted into a flipbook format. The feasibility test results show that the interactive e-booklet received a rating of ?highly feasible? from 86% of media experts, 97% of content experts, 98% of peer reviewers, 96.5% of biology teachers, and 94% of students.
